What companies run services between Angers, France and Venice, Italy?

You can take a train from Angers St Laud to Venezia S. Lucia via Lyon Part Dieu and Milano Centrale in around 12h 28m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Angers - Bus Station Esplanade to Venezia, Tronchetto via Paris - Bercy-Seine Bus Station and Paris, Quai de Bercy (Bercy Seine) in around 22h 20m.
